Water hydrant replacement services involve removing outdated or damaged fire hydrants and installing new units to ensure reliable access to water in emergency situations. The process typically includes disconnecting the existing hydrant, preparing the site, and securely installing a new hydrant that meets local standards. These services may also involve inspecting the surrounding water lines to confirm proper connection and functionality, helping to maintain the safety and efficiency of fire protection systems within a community or property.
Replacing a water hydrant addresses several common problems, such as corrosion, leaks, or mechanical failure that can compromise water flow and fire safety. Over time, hydrants can become worn or damaged due to exposure to the elements, frequent use, or ground shifting. Upgrading or replacing hydrants helps prevent potential water supply interruptions, reduces the risk of property damage caused by leaks, and ensures that emergency responders have access to a dependable water source when needed.

The overview below groups typical Water Hydrant Replacement proj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Douglas County, CO.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Replacement Costs - The cost for water hydrant replacement typically ranges from $1,200 to $3,500 per unit, depending on the hydrant type and location. For example, a standard residential hydrant may cost around $1,500, while larger commercial models can reach higher prices.
Labor Expenses - Labor costs for replacing a water hydrant usually fall between $500 and $1,500, influenced by site accessibility and complexity of the installation. More intricate setups or difficult access points tend to increase labor charges.
Material Fees - The price of materials, including new hydrants and fittings, generally ranges from $700 to $2,000 per unit. Premium or specialized hydrants can cost more, depending on specifications and brand choices.
Additional Costs - Extra expenses may include permits, site restoration, or utility adjustments, often adding $200 to $800 to the overall cost. These factors vary based on local regulations and project scope.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

How often should water hydrants be replaced? Replacement frequency depends on factors like usage, age, and corrosion; a professional can assess whether a hydrant needs replacement.
What signs indicate a water hydrant needs replacement? Signs include leaks, rust, reduced water flow, or difficulty operating the hydrant, which may suggest it’s time for a replacement.
Can water hydrant replacement be done during any season? Most contractors can perform replacements year-round, but weather conditions may influence scheduling; consult with local service providers for availability.
What is involved in replacing a water hydrant? The process typically includes removing the old hydrant, preparing the connection point, and installing a new unit, handled by experienced service providers.
How long does a water hydrant replacement usually take? The duration varies based on site conditions but generally ranges from a few hours to a full day, depending on the complexity of the work.
